A soft microfiber towel or a sponge mop can be used to clean windows. Make sure to wash your blade first to stop any debris from gathering under it. Using a rubber-bladed squeegee is one more helpful cleaning device. This device needs to be held versus the bottom of the home window and also angled downward. Wipe the window dry with a dry cloth after each pass. You can likewise make use of a newspaper web page to dry home windows. For larger home windows, you can utilize a squeegee. These devices come with an expansion that you can screw on. The Unger squeegee's rubber edge is extra effective than a towel and also has 50 years of experience.

It includes a rubber pointer as well as a tilted layout that pulls the glass in a downward movement. You can utilize it to clean up the sides and the bottom of home windows.
